Outlandish behavior. Of the 18 outlandish behavior claims litigated, administrators<br />

prevailed in 4 cases (22%). Schools prevailed in 11 cases (61%), and 3 cases were split decisions<br />

(17%).<br />

Upstanding behaviors. Of the 5 upstanding behavior claims litigated, administrators<br />

prevailed in 3 cases (60%). Schools prevailed in 2 cases (40%).<br />

Outcomes--Employee Protection Issues<br />

Due process. Of the 41 due process claims litigated, administrators prevailed in 6 cases<br />

(15%). Schools prevailed in 27 cases (66%), and 7 cases were split decisions (17%). One case<br />

was remanded for rehearing (2%).<br />

First Amendment claims. Of the 19 First Amendment claims litigated, administrators<br />

prevailed in 2 cases (10%). Schools prevailed in 11 cases (58%). Six cases were split decisions<br />

(32%).<br />

Tenure violations. Of the 24 tenure violation claims litigated, administrators prevailed in<br />

5 cases (21%). Schools prevailed in 16 cases (66%). Two cases were split decisions (8%), and 1<br />

case was remanded for rehearing (4%).<br />

Breach of contract. Of the 15 breach of contract claims litigated, administrators prevailed<br />

in five cases (33%). Schools prevailed in six cases (40%). Four cases were split decisions (27%).<br />
